In a recent letter Lyklema and Evertsz (see ibid., vol.19, p.895-900 (1986)) found a value of nu for the eta =1 Laplacian random walk which differs from the value the authors obtained for the diffusion-limited self-avoiding walk (DLSAW). They show that this results from different boundary conditions at the ends of these chains and not from a failing in our Monte Carlo studies of the DLSAW.
